Athens ran in ten tries against Spartans in another convincing display that keeps them clear at the top of the championship after five rounds.
Athens number eight Philippos Sotiriadis then picked up off the back of a ruck inside the Spartans 22 for try number three while veteran wing Kaloxilos showed he still has plenty in the tank with two tries before the break.
